Yamaha YZF R7 Parts

Engine and Transmission

The Yamaha YZF R7 is a 4 stroke, Sport bike with a Liquid cooled 749.00 ccm (45,47 cubic inches) In-line four type of engine. This engine then gets the power to the rear wheel with a Chain driven transmission.

This engine has 100.00 HP (72,64 kW)) @ 11000 RPM, 72.00 Nm (7,26 kgf-m or 52,83 ft.lbs) @ 9000 RPM and a top speed of 250.0 km/h (154,52 mph)

Fuel System

For weekend adventures, the tank size is an essential aspect. The Yamaha YZF R7 includes a 23.00 litres (6,05 gallons) fuel tank, giving consistent range for your adventures.

Yamaha YZF R7 Technical Specifications

Type: In-line four
Displacement: 749.00 ccm (45,47 cubic inches)
Power: 100.00 HP (72,64 kW)) @ 11000 RPM
Torque: 72.00 Nm (7,26 kgf-m or 52,83 ft.lbs) @ 9000 RPM
Compression: N/A
Stroke: 4
Cooling: Liquid
Valves: N/A
Starter: Electric
Transmission: Chain
Gearbox: 6 - speed
Top Speed: 250.0 km/h (154,52 mph)
Fuel Capacity: 23.00 litres (6,05 gallons)
Fuel Control: N/A
Type: Sport
Year: 2000
Weight: 176.0 kg (386,06 pounds)
Length: N/A
Front Brakes: Dual disc
Rear Brakes: Single disc
